Job description

Forward Financing is a Boston-based financial technology company with an operational hub in the Dominican Republic, on a mission to unlock the capital that fuels small businesses across America. Recognized as a Best Place to Work by Built In Boston and certified as a Great Place To Work, Forward is investing in its employees, technology, and customer experience – with long-term success in mind every step of the way.

The Underwriting Analyst will evaluate business data to assess financing eligibility and determine risk-adjusted pricing decisions.

In this role you will:

  • Learn and follow Forward Financing’s process and guidelines to confidently issue profitable underwriting decisions.
  • Analyze and interpret small business data related to financing applications to determine the appropriate amount of capital that the business can afford.
  • Gauge risk profile while understanding customers’ business needs, opportunities and challenges.
  • Advise internal sales reps to offer appealing small business financing options.
  • Work with other members of the Underwriting department on initiatives to improve processes.

Required Skills and Experience:

  • Bachelor's degree.
  • Ability to pick up on patterns in data and make good decisions based on these patterns.
  • Analytical and self-motivated professional with a track record of exercising good judgment when making business decisions.
  • Proficient in reviewing data and making decisions in situations that contain some level of ambiguity.
